Deprecation overview
As our product and API evolves, we occasionally retire older endpoints and services. We provide advance notice for all deprecations to ensure you have ample time to migrate.
Definitions:
- Announcement Date: The date we officially communicated the deprecation.
- EOL (Shutdown) Date: The date the service will be taken offline, no longer maintained or/and stop functioning entirely.
Current status
| Service / Feature | Status | Announcement Date | EOL (Shutdown) Date | Replacement & Guides |
|---|---|---|---|---|
Legacy Webhooks v1 | Deprecated | May 21st, 2026 | Nov 30th, 2026 | Migrate to Webhooks v2. View Webhook Migration Guide |
PHP SDK | Upcoming | June 30th, 2026 | (TBD) | (TBD) |
.NET SDK | Upcoming | June 30th, 2026 | (TBD) | (TBD) |
Status definition:
- Upcoming: We have decided to deprecate this service and listed it here for visibility, but have not yet formally announced it. No customer notification has been sent, and the Announcement and EOL dates are not yet confirmed.
- Deprecated: We have formally announced the deprecation and notified affected customers. The service still functions and receives critical/security fixes only, but will be shut down on the stated EOL date. Migrate to the listed replacement before then.
- Retired: The EOL date has passed and the service is offline. Requests will fail or return errors. Retained here as a historical record.
Progression: Upcoming → Deprecated → Retired.
